How they compare
Namibia currently reports 15.4% against 15.3% in Sudan,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 45 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Sudan ahead.
Namibia ranks 153rd and Sudan ranks 154th of 198 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Namibia averaged higher in 4 and Sudan in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Namibia | Sudan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 3.6% | 3.6% | 0.0% | Sudan |
| 1990s | 5.4% | 5.0% | 0.4% | Namibia |
| 2000s | 8.5% | 7.5% | 1.0% | Namibia |
| 2010s | 11.9% | 10.8% | 1.1% | Namibia |
| 2020s | 14.6% | 14.2% | 0.4% | Namibia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
